Fresh Peach Cobbler Recipe: A Sweet Summer Treat

Ingredients You'll Need:

For the Peach Filling:

  • 6 cups fresh peaches, peeled, pitted, and sliced (about 6-8 medium peaches)
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ice

For the Cobbler Topping:

  • 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up (1 stick) cold unsalted butter, cut into small pieces
  • 1/2 cup milk

Instructions:

Preparing the Peach Filling:

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ease a 9x13 inch baking dish.
  2. Combine the peaches, sugar, flour, cinnamon, nutmeg, and lemon juice in a large bowl. Gently toss to coat the peaches evenly. Pour the mixture into the prepared baking dish.

Making the Cobbler Topping:

  1. In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
  2. Cut in the cold butter using a pastry blender or your fingers until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
  3. Stir in the milk until just combined. Don't overmix; a few lumps are okay.

Assembling and Baking the Cobbler:

  1. Spoon the cobbler topping evenly over the peach filling.
  2. Bake for 45-50 minutes, or until the topping is golden brown and the filling is bubbly.
  3. Let the cobbler cool slightly before serving. Enjoy warm, perhaps with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or a dollop of whipped cream!

Tips for the Perfect Peach Cobbler:

  • Use ripe, but not overripe, peaches. Overripe peaches will make the filling too soft.
  • Don't overmix the topping. Overmixing will result in a tough topping.
  • If you prefer a crispier topping, bake the cobbler for a few extra minutes.
  • Feel free to experiment with different spices. A dash of cardamom or allspice would be delicious additions.
  • Make it ahead! This cobbler can be made a day ahead and reheated before serving.
